Identifying harmful gas in the atmosphere.

Chemistry Level 2

In order to test the air quality in an area, people take 2 liters of air and then use it to aerate a P b ( N O 3 ) 2 Pb(NO_3)_2 solution.

After all chemical reactions have stopped, a black precipitate weighing 0 , 3585 m g 0,3585mg is gained in the process.

Which of the following must have been in the air? Choose the best answer.

N O 2 NO_2 H 2 S H_2S S O 2 SO_2 C l 2 Cl_2 C O CO All of the other answers are incorrect.

PbS is black in color and is formed as a precipitated residue when Pb(NO3)2 reacts with H2S .
